What Is Debt Settlement and How Does It Work? Debt settlement or debt negotiation might be an affordable debt relief alternative to bankruptcy For most customers who're certainly struggling to satisfy their financial obligations or have quite higher balances on their credit cards. While the target of debt consolidation or debt management will be to payoff the complete level of a number of significant interest debts, just in a lower interest rate and by way of a single consolidated monthly payment; the intention of debt settlement is to barter with creditors in hopes that they will concur to accept a minimized amount of money when compared with what was originally owed. Debt settlement or debt negotiation can give an honorable strategy For lots of shoppers to pay for back a part of the debts without declaring bankruptcy, and most likely help save a considerable amount of money in the method. Whilst the chance to conserve a considerable amount of cash with debt settlement, it is vital to take into account that there can be downsides to this form of debt relief.

Medical bill settlement: Another option available to you is usually to try and settle your medical debts, which you'll be able to do with or without the help of the debt settlement agency. Essentially, settling your medical bills would include getting in touch with your creditors and featuring to pay money straight away for some total below The existing total you owe (some sources counsel seventy five % medical debt by race of whatever your bill totals are).
